The order allows the Department to shift any such items not currently needed or needed in the short term future by a health care facility, to be transferred to a facility in urgent need of such inventory. The Department must either return the inventory as soon as it is no longer urgently needed or ensure compensation is paid for it at the prevailing market rate at the time of acquisition. Governor Cuomo's September 4, 2020 executive order continues the suspension and tolling of any specific time limit for "the commencement, filing, or service of any legal action, notice, motion, or other process or proceeding" for the period from March 20, 2020 (the date of Tolling Order) through October 4, 2020. A 14-day decline in hospitalizations and hospital deaths (or fewer than 15 new hospitalizations and five deaths in a three-day average); New hospitalizations remain less than two per 100,000 residents on a three-day average; Hospitals maintain 30 percent vacancy of their bed capacity for any resurgence, including intensive care units; Monthly COVID-19 testing of at least 30 of every 1,000 residents in a region; At least 30 "contact tracers" per 100,000 residents; Hospitals in each region must have a 90-day stockpile of personal protective equipment. The quarantine applies to any person arriving from an area with a positive test rate higher than 10 per 100,000 residents over a 7-day rolling average or an area with a 10 percent or higher positivity rate over a 7-day rolling average. Credit reporting agencies will: Governor Cuomo issued Executive Order 202.42, which modifies Executive Orders 202.35 and 202.38 (limiting the size gatherings to ten people) to allow gatherings of 25 or fewer individuals, for any lawful purpose or reason, provided that the location of the gathering is in a region that has reached Phase 3 of the States reopening, and social distancing protocols and cleaning and disinfection protocols required by the Department of Health are adhered to. Effective at 12:01 a.m. on Friday, May 15, though, reductions and restrictions on the in-person workforce at non-essential businesses or other entities no longer apply to Construction, Agriculture, Forestry, Fishing and Hunting, Retail (Limited to curbside or in-store pickup or drop off), Manufacturing, and Wholesale Trade in regions that meet the prescribed health and safety metrics.
